Web3 Content Platform Tomoland Completes $2M Funding Round Led by Sky9 Capital

GateNews
According to BlockBeats, Web3 user-generated content platform Tomoland completed a $2 million funding round today (May 20), led by Sky9 Capital. WAGMI Ventures, Aureus Dealers, and angel investors from Meta, Depinx Capital, Netease, and Virtuals also participated in the round. The company plans to use the funds to build a platform combining user-generated content with Web3 ownership mechanisms.
